How Much Should a Shih Tzu Puppy Eat?
- Many shih tzu owners leave a bowl of dry dog food out all day. The puppy can eat when it feels hungry. This method provides the animal with ample nutrition to meet its growing needs.
- According to the All Shih Tzu website, a shih tzu puppy needs to be fed three times a day. It should eat one ounce of food for every pound that it weighs. For example, if the puppy weighs five pounds, it should eat five ounces of food at each meal.
- A scheduled and measured diet is healthier for shih tzu puppies. Free-fed puppies do not develop disciplined eating habits. In addition, it is difficult to get the puppy into a housebreaking routine if it can eat whenever it likes.
